#3f5842 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f5842 is composed of 24.7% red, 34.5%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.2 degrees, a saturation of 16.6% and a lightness of 29.6%. #3f5842 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eb084 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3f5842 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#3f5842 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f5842 has RGB values of R:63, G:88,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4151362.

Shades and Tints of #3f5842
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060806 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f5842
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4c4b is the less saturated color, while #059216 is the most saturated one.
